I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Dotnet Discussion :

Reactive Extensions devient open source


Sujet :

Dotnet

  1. #1
    Rédacteur
    Avatar de Hinault Romaric
    Homme Profil pro
    Consultant
    Inscrit en
    Janvier 2007
    Messages
    4 570
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Cameroun

    Informations professionnelles :
    Activité : Consultant
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Janvier 2007
    Messages : 4 570
    Points : 252 372
    Points
    252 372
    Billets dans le blog
    121
    Par défaut Reactive Extensions devient open source
    Reactive Extensions devient open source
    Microsoft publie le code du Framework qui rend simple la programmation asynchrone en .NET, JavaScript et C++

    Le virage vers l’open source adopté par Microsoft pour plusieurs de ses outils de développement continue (voir sur le même sujet).

    La firme vient d’annoncer le passage des Reactive Extensions (Rx) à Microsoft Open Technology, sa filiale en charge des projets open source.

    Reactive Extensions est un projet du laboratoire Devlabs de Microsoft, qui a connu une certaine notoriété, car il a été développé par l’équipe d’Erik Meijer, le créateur de LINQ.

    Rx est un ensemble de bibliothèques qui rend la programmation asynchrone beaucoup plus simple. Le Framework est un modèle de programmation qui permet aux développeurs de lier des flux de données asynchrones.

    Rx est particulièrement utile pour la programmation parallèle ou le développement Cloud, parce qu’il permet de créer une interface commune pour des applications exploitant diverses sources de données.

    Le Framework permet aux développeurs de représenter les flux de données comme une collection asynchrone (IObservable) , de les interroger à l’aide des opérateurs LINQ, puis d'orchestrer le traitement avec des ordonnanceurs.

    Reactive Extensions est utilisé par Microsoft sur plusieurs de ses produits. Le client GitHub pour Windows repose également sur le Framework pour les transferts réseaux, les événements d’interface utilisateur et bien plus.

    Microsoft a déplacé le code source du projet sur CodePlex, qui est désormais téléchargeable sous les termes de la licence Apache 2.0.

    Le projet sera désormais maintenu par Microsoft Open Technology et son équipe actuelle, qui pourront compter sur la participation des communautés open source qui veulent adopter Rx.

    Rx est disponible en plusieurs déclinaisons dont Rx.NET pour les applications .NET, RxJS pour les développeurs Web utilisant JavaScript et Rx++ pour les langages C et C++.

    Rx sur CodePlex


    Source : Microsoft


    Et vous ?

    Qu'en pensez ?

  2. #2
    Expert confirmé

    Profil pro
    Inscrit en
    Février 2006
    Messages
    2 396
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 2 396
    Points : 5 016
    Points
    5 016
    Par défaut
    visiblement on ne peut pas s'en servir tel quel sous visual c++ 2010, dommage.
    je testerai ça quand j'aurai soit vs2012, soit du temps pour essayer de le faire fonctionner sous 2010.

Discussions similaires

  1. Réponses: 7
    Dernier message: 01/11/2011, 00h40
  2. [MIDlet Pascal] MIDlet Pascal devient open source dans sa version 3.0
    Par petitprince dans le forum Autres IDE
    Réponses: 24
    Dernier message: 14/07/2010, 01h10
  3. TxQuery devient Open Source
    Par Andnotor dans le forum Contribuez
    Réponses: 3
    Dernier message: 09/02/2010, 16h47
  4. IntelliJ Idea devient Open Source !
    Par Baptiste Wicht dans le forum IntelliJ
    Réponses: 27
    Dernier message: 02/11/2009, 12h46
  5. Réponses: 11
    Dernier message: 02/08/2007, 16h07

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o